CII delegation interacts with Deputy Head of Mission, Embassy of Republic of Poland
FacebookTwitterWhatsapp

Srinagar: A three-member Confederation of Indian Industry (CII) delegation led by Vice-Chairman CII J&K Council and Managing Director Golden Agrisense Pvt Ltd, Ehsan Javed, held an interaction with Anna Rosenthal, First Secretary-Deputy Head of Mission, Embassy of the Republic of Poland at Srinagar.

The delegation discussed possible areas of cooperation between Polish companies and industries in J&K. Javed informed Rosenthal that as a first step we will explore areas of agriculture and Horticulture for possible collaboration.

Rosenthal expressed interest in the suggestion and invited Javed to the special Apple Festival to be held in the Embassy of Poland at New Delhi. Rosenthal also informed the CII delegation that Poland has expertise in Waste to Energy technology, healthcare and smart cities technologies.

Javed assured that CII will work as a catalyst for the investment of Polish companies in J&K.

Mushtaq Bashir, Member CII J&K Council informed Rosenthal about the Downtown Football Club being run by them and also expressed interest in the possible exchange between Football players of Poland and Kashmir.

Rosenthal expressed interest in a possible sporting exchange between J&K and Poland.

On the occasion, Bashir presented a special team jersey to Rosenthal.

Head CII J&K Council, Khurshid Dar, thanked Anna Rosenthal for interacting with CII Delegation and also assured support of CII in taking ahead of the agenda of economic cooperation.
